Marketing is Important in Day-to-Day Life

  • Marketing plays a crucial role in a person’s daily life, whether at home, in the office, at an educational institution, or while working from home.
  • It impacts consumers on physical, psychological, financial, and emotional levels.
  • Understanding marketing helps in making better purchasing decisions and enhances overall consumer awareness.

The Seven Ways to Heaven

  • The ‘Seven Ways to Heaven’ is a structured approach to understanding marketing’s significance in daily life.
  • These seven elements form the foundation of an effective marketing process.

Let’s explore how marketing influences our daily decisions and experiences.

The first element is noise
  • There is so much noise around us in the form of marketing, advertising, and promotional messages.
  • Various brands and sub-brands compete for our attention through multiple media—physical, digital, offline, and online.
  • Every day, marketing surrounds us with an overwhelming amount of brand products and brand services.
The second element is choice
  • Marketing plays an important role because we must make a choice amidst the noise.
  • Various brand offerings lead us through the decision-making process, requiring us to select the right brand of product or service.
  • Whether it is a bar of soap, a bar of chocolate, a sound bar, or even visiting a restaurant bar, choices are constantly being made.
  • These choices apply to both individual and group consumption, whether within families or workplaces.
  • As marketing touches us daily, its importance grows based on the decisions we make with friends and family.
The third element is voice
  • We need to express ourselves and use our voice in the marketing process—whether to ask questions, give suggestions, seek information, or share opinions.
  • Marketing enables consumers to voice their preferences, influencing decisions at various levels.
  • This could include selecting a TV channel, a program, a newspaper, or a magazine.
  • Through this daily interaction with brands and services, our voice becomes a powerful tool—whether to enquire about or acquire a brand.
The fourth element is wise
  • Once we have navigated through the noise, made a choice, and expressed ourselves through our voice, it is time to be wise.
  • This means analyzing the pros and cons of a decision, not just in terms of cost-effectiveness, but also regarding health, beauty, and quality of life for ourselves and our families.
  • Marketing plays a crucial role in helping us make informed and thoughtful decisions.
  • Sometimes, we may make mistakes, but through these experiences, we learn and grow.
  • The marketing process in our daily lives continuously refines our ability to make wise decisions.
The fifth element is invoice
  • The importance of marketing in our daily lives is also highlighted through the concept of the invoice—our ability to spend wisely or save.
  • Once we have gone through noise, choice, voice, and wisdom, the next step is to be financially prudent.
  • Marketing teaches us the value of savings, judicious spending, negotiation, and getting the best deal without compromising on quality and affordability.
  • The invoice is a representation of our financial decisions, ensuring that we make purchases that benefit both ourselves and our families.
The sixth element is poise
  • Now that the decision has been made, marketing allows us to use the brand offering with poise.
  • Whether purchasing household goods, branded jewelry, clothing, food, beverages, or even a home delivery service, we use these products with a sense of style and confidence among family and friends.
  • Marketing enhances our standard of living and quality of life, helping us build a positive self-image and increasing our perceived value in our own eyes and in the eyes of others.
  • The ability to use products and services with poise is an important outcome of the marketing process in our daily lives.
The seventh element is rejoice
  • After navigating through noise, making a choice, expressing our voice, becoming wise, carefully handling the invoice, and living with poise, the final step is to rejoice.
  • Marketing influences our daily lives by not only educating us and helping us make sensible decisions but also by enriching our experiences.
  • It allows us to enjoy life safely and securely, pleasantly and enjoyably, bringing us small joys on a daily basis.
  • This entire journey—the ‘Seven Ways to Heaven’—demonstrates how marketing is deeply integrated into our lives, ultimately leading us to greater happiness and fulfillment.
